    Heat pumps have been gaining momentum in recent years as an alternative to traditional HVAC systems. Yet many people still don't understand the features that make heat pumps so attractive. If you would like to increase your knowledge of heat pumps, read on. This article will present three important things to know. Heat pumps are used to both heat and cool a home. Don't let their name fool you: heat pumps aren't just used to heat a home.
